作为一位新手公民开发者,掌握如何撰写易懂的技术文档是一项至关重要的技能。这不仅有助于提高项目的可维护性,还能帮助团队成员和用户更好地理解和使用你的代码。下面,我将为你详细解析如何轻松撰写易懂的技术文档。
了解技术文档的重要性
在开始撰写技术文档之前,首先需要明确其重要性。技术文档是软件开发过程中的重要组成部分,它可以帮助:
- 提高代码可维护性:通过详细的文档,团队成员可以更快地理解代码逻辑,从而提高代码的可维护性。
- 促进知识共享:技术文档是团队内部知识共享的重要途径,有助于新成员快速融入项目。
- 提升用户体验:对于开源项目或商业产品,良好的技术文档可以提升用户体验,降低用户的学习成本。
选择合适的文档工具
选择一款合适的文档工具是撰写技术文档的第一步。以下是一些常用的文档工具:
- Markdown:轻量级标记语言,易于学习和使用,支持多种平台。
- GitBook:基于Node.js的静态站点生成器,适用于构建书籍或文档。
- Docusaurus:由Facebook开发的静态站点生成器,适用于构建文档网站。
撰写技术文档的基本结构
一个完整的技术文档通常包含以下结构:
1. 标题和简介
- 标题:简洁明了地描述文档主题。
- 简介:简要介绍文档的目的和适用范围。
2. 安装和配置
- 环境要求:列出编写和运行代码所需的软件和硬件环境。
- 安装步骤:详细描述如何安装和配置所需软件。
3. 使用说明
- 功能介绍:介绍代码或产品的功能特点。
- 使用示例:通过代码示例展示如何使用功能。
4. 代码示例
- 示例代码:提供具有代表性的代码示例,帮助读者理解功能实现。
- 代码解释:对示例代码进行详细解释,说明代码逻辑和实现方法。
5. 注意事项
- 限制条件:列出使用功能时需要注意的限制条件。
- 常见问题:列举用户在使用过程中可能遇到的问题及解决方案。
6. 版本更新记录
- 更新日志:记录文档的修改历史,包括新增功能、修复的bug等。
撰写技巧
以下是撰写技术文档时的一些技巧:
- 简洁明了:避免使用过于复杂的语言,确保文档易于理解。
- 图文并茂:使用图表、截图等视觉元素,使文档更直观易懂。
- 逻辑清晰:按照一定的逻辑顺序组织内容,使读者能够轻松跟随思路。
- 持续更新:及时更新文档,确保内容的准确性和时效性。
总结
撰写易懂的技术文档对于新手公民开发者来说是一项重要的技能。通过了解技术文档的重要性、选择合适的工具、掌握基本结构以及运用撰写技巧,你将能够轻松地撰写出高质量的技术文档。希望本文能对你有所帮助。
